آژانس دیجیتال مارکتینگ هیواوب

خطای HTTP 500: مشکل از کجاست و چگونه آن را برطرف کرد؟

خطای HTTP 500

فهرست مطالب

خطای HTTP 500 چیست؟ شما نمی دانید دقیقاً چه اتفاقی افتاده یا چه مشکلی پیش اومده است! تنها چیزی که می دانید این است که یه چیزی اشتباه است و باید آن را برطرف کنید. با شرکت هیوا وب همراه باشید تا به رفع مشکل خطای مخرب HTTP 500 سرور داخلی بپردازیم. بیایید به معنی دقیق آن و رایج ترین علل و راه حل های آن بپردازیم.

خطای HTTP 500 چیست؟

خطای HTTP 500

 

خطای سرور داخلی HTTP 500 بدین معناست که سرور وب شما با مشکل مواجه شده است. اما نمی تواند خطای خاص یا علل اصلی آن را مشخص کند. هنگامی که این اتفاق می افتد، وب سایت شما یک صفحه وب با خطای 500 را به بازدیدکنندگان سایت شما ارائه می دهد.

چگونه می توان خطای سرور داخلی 500 را برطرف کرد؟

بر خلاف خطاهای دیگر سرور مانند کد 502 یا کد 503، خطای 500 سرور داخلی این است که بلافاصله به شما نمی گوید مشکل چیست و همچنین نحوه رفع آن را نیز به شما نمی گوید. اگر خطا برای مدت طولانی در سایت شما ادامه یابد، حتی می تواند بر سئو شما تأثیر منفی بگذارد.

بنابراین، بیایید به چند علت احتمالی خطا بپردازیم. سپس، ما چند راه حل ارائه می دهیم تا بتوانید مشکل را برطرف کنید.

دلایل احتمالی خطای HTTP 500

خطای سرور داخلی 500 همانطور که از نامش مشخص است یک مشکل کلی در سرور وب سایت است. به احتمال زیاد، این بدان معناست که مشکلی یا نقص موقتی در برنامه نویسی وب سایت وجود دارد.

برخی از علل احتمالی خطای 500 سرور داخلی عبارتند از:

برخی از علل احتمالی خطای 500

 

  • فایل .htaccess خراب است
  • خطای مجوزها
  • افزونه ها یا تم ها معیوب
  • از محدودیت حافظه PHP فراتر رفته است

خوشبختانه چند راه حل موثرثر برای رفع اکثر این مشکلات وجود دارد.

چند روش برای رفع شدن احتمالی خطای HTTP 500 وجود دارد

 

1. صفحه را رفرش refresh کنید.

اگر مشکل بارگذاری موقت باشد، صفحه را رفرش کنید، ممکن است وب سایت بالا بیاد و موفق شوید.

2. بعداً به سایت سر بزنید

از آنجا که خطا در سمت سرور است، چند دقیقه یا حداکثر تا یک ساعت به آن زمان دهید و سپس URL را بارگذاری کنید و ببینید آیا تیم توسعه دهنده مشکل را برطرف کرده است.

3. کوکی های مرورگر خود را حذف کنید.

اگر پاک کردن سابقه مرورگر کار نمی کند، ممکن است کوکی های مرورگر خود را حذف کنید. اگر کوکی ها با صفحه وب که با خطا مرتبط هستند، حذف کوکی ها ممکن است به بارگیری مجدد صفحه کمک کند.

ممکن است با این روش خطا از بین نرود. پس روش های دیگری رو امتحان میکنیم.

روش های دیگر برای رفع خطای HTTP 500

 

1. افزونه یا تم را غیرفعال کنید.

افزونه یا تم را غیرفعال کنید

 

نرم افزارهای تازه فعال شده افزونه ها یا اسکریپت ها ممکن است با پیکربندی سرور فعلی شما مغایرت داشته باشد. برای تعیین این امر، سعی کنید افزونه های نرم افزاری خود را یکی یکی غیرفعال یا حذف کنید تا مشخص شود که دقیقاً چه چیزی باعث خطای سرور داخلی می شود.

اگر وب سایت وردپرس را اجرا می کنید، این کار با افزونه ها آسان است. از داشبورد خود، افزونه ها و افزونه های نصب شده را انتخاب کنید. سپس اولین افزونه را غیرفعال کنید. اگر خطا برطرف شد، متوجه میشویم که این افزونه بخشی از مشکل است. افزونه اول را مجدداً فعال کنید، سپس این فرآیند غیرفعال کردن-فعالسازی را یکی یکی تکرار کنید تا همه افزونه ها تشخیص دهند کدام یک باعث خطای HTTP 500 شما می شوند.

 

2. از افزونه ای مانند WP Debugging برای شناسایی مشکل استفاده کنید.

اگر سایت شما از وردپرس استفاده می کند و از اشکال زدایی وردپرس راحت هستید، نصب افزونه ای را در نظر بگیرید که به شما کمک می کند مشکل را با سرور خود تشخیص دهید. به عنوان مثال، افزونه اشکال زدایی WP Debugging به شما کمک می کند بفهمید که دقیقاً چه مشکلی در سایت شما وجود دارد ، که منجر به رفع سریعتر می شود.

3. مطمعن شوید که تنظیمات PHP شما به درستی پیکربندی شده است.

مجوزهای اشتباه در فایل یا پوشه ای که دارای اسکریپت است، مانند اسکریپت PHP یا CGI، اجازه اجرای اسکریپت را نمی دهد. مجوزهای خود را بررسی کنید و مطمئن شوید که آنها را به درستی روی سرور خود تنظیم کرده اید.

4. کد فایل .htaccess سایت خود را بررسی کنید.

کد فایل .htaccess سایت خود را بررسی کنید

 

کدنویسی نادرست یا ساختار نامناسب با فایل .htaccess شما می تواند دلیل مشاهده خطای داخلی 500 باشد. فایل .htaccess به شما کمک می کند تا مدت زمانی که منابع باید در حافظه پنهان مرورگر ذخیره شوند را مدیریت کنید. در صورت مشاهده خطای سرور داخلی 500 ، فایل را ویرایش کنید. به احتمال زیاد سرور شما این فایل را به طور پیش فرض از دید پنهان می کند و برای دیدن آن باید فایل های مخفی را روشن کنید. این یکی از رایج ترین خطای HTTP 500 که در این فایل رخ می دهد

5. از نصب صحیح نرم افزار جدید خود اطمینان حاصل کنید.

در اخر، بررسی کنید که آیا نرم افزاری اخیراً نصب شده یا ارتقا یافته یا نه. از نصب کامل و صحیح نرم افزار مطمعن شوید.

ممنونیم از شما که تا پایان این مقاله همراه ما بودید. در ضمن شرکت طراحی سایت هیوا وب برای کسب و کارهای فعال در اینستاگرام خدمات مختلفی شامل طراحی سایت، تولید محتوا و سایر خدمات مربوط به اینستاگرام را ارائه می دهد. اگر برای کسب کار خودتون وب سایت ندارید میتونید از طریق لینک قیمت طراحی سایت از تعرفه های طراحی سایت مطلع شوید و از مشاوره های رایگان هیوا وب استفاده کنید.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*